@CHARSET "UTF-8";
html{
	height:100%;
}
html>body {
	min-height: 100%;
	height: auto;
}
body{
	text-align: center;
	height: 100%;
	font-family: Lucida Grande, Verdana, Arial, Helvetica, sans-serif;
	font-size: 12px;
	line-height: 16px;
	overflow-x: hidden;
	background: url('../images/1pxblack.jpg');
	color: #4b4b4b;
}
* {
	margin: 0px;
	padding: 0px;
}
/* default page settings */ 
h1{
	font-size: 32px;
	line-height: 34px;
	margin: 0 0 6px 0px;
	color: #575756;
	font-weight: bold;
}
#bc0 {
	font-size: 32px;
	line-height: 34px;
	margin: 0 0 6px 0px;
	color: #575756;
	font-weight: bold;
}


h2{
	font-size: 24px;
	line-height: 24px;
	color: #575756;
	font-weight: normal;
}

#bc1 {
	font-size: 24px;
	line-height: 30px;
	color: #575756;
	font-weight: normal;
	margin: 0 0 5px 0;
}

h3 
{
	font-size: 16px;
	line-height: 25px;
	color: #575756;
	font-weight: normal;
	margin: 0 0 5px 0;
}

h4 {
	font-weight: bold;
	color: #fff;
	font-size:10px;
}

h5 {
	font-size:11px;
	margin:0;
	padding:0;
	line-height:14px;
}

h6 {
	font-family: Lucida Grande, Verdana, Arial, Helvetica, sans-serif;
	font-size: 15px;
	color:#57584d;
	margin:0;
}

#bc2,
#bc3,
#bc4,
#bc5
{
display:none;
}

p {
	margin: 0px;
	padding: 0px;
	font-size: 11px;
	line-height: 16px;
	color: #4b4b4b;
}
ul {
	margin: 0 0 0 10px;
}
ul li {
	list-style-type: disc;
}
div{
	text-align: left;
	font-size: 11px;
	line-height: 16px;	
	color: #4b4b4b;
}
a:link,
a:active,
a:visited
{
	text-decoration: none;
	color: #4b4b4b;
}
a:hover
{
	text-decoration: none;
	color: #0096d5
}
img {
	border: 0;	
}
.clear {
	clear:both;
}
.floatLeft {
	float:left;
}
.floatRight {
	float:right;
}
.relative {
	position:relative;
}
.absolute {
	position:absolute;
}
table, tr, td {
	border: 0;	
}
table.tb-wrap {
	width: 100%;
	height: 100%;	
}

fieldset {
	border:0;
}

/* Main section */
#flashcontainer {
	height: 0px;
}
#flashcontent {
	width: 1000px;
	height: 0px;
	margin-left:auto;
	margin-right:auto;	
	position: relative;
}
#flashcontainerdetails {
	height: 0px;
width:100%;
}
#flashcontentdetails {
	width: 1000px;
	height: 0px;
	margin-left:auto;
	margin-right:auto;	
	position: relative;
}
#bgbottomcolors {
	width: 100%;
	height: 100%;
	background: url('../images/bgcolors.jpg') repeat-x top center;		
}
#header {
	height: 352px;
}
#headerdetails {
	height: 160px;
}
html>body #maincontainer {
	min-height: 480px;
	height: auto;
}
#maincontainer {
	width: 1000px;
	height: 480px;
	margin-left:auto;
	margin-right:auto;	
	position:relative;
}
html>body #maincontainerdetails {
	min-height: 160px;
	height: auto;
}
#maincontainerdetails {
	width: 1000px;
	height: 160px;
	margin-left:auto;
	margin-right:auto;	
	position:relative;
}
#flashobject {
	width: 1100px;
	height: 475px;
	position: absolute;
	top: 0px;
	left: 0px;
	z-index: 100;
}
#flashobject2 {
	width: 1000px;
	height: 90px;
	position: absolute;
	top: 0px;
	left: 0px;
	z-index: 100;
}
#topleftnav
{
	height:88px;
	width: 25%;
	background:#000;
	position:absolute;
	left:0;
	top:0;
}
#toprightnav {
	height:88px;
	left:990px;
	width: 80%;
	background:url('../images/bgtopnav_line.png') repeat-x;
	z-index:5;
	position:absolute;
}
#topnav {
	position:absolute;
	top:0px;
	left:0px;
	height:88px;
	width:100%;
	background:url('../images/bgtopnav.png') no-repeat;
}
#logo {
	position:absolute;
	top:10px;
	left:0px;
	display: none;
}


html>body #sectionfeatures {
	min-height: 120px;
	height: auto;
}
#sectionfeatures {
	position:relative;
	background:#fff;
	height: 145px;
	padding: 25px 0 0 0;
}
#sectfeatcnt {
	width: 1000px;
	margin-left: auto;
	margin-right: auto;
}
.boxfeature {
	width: 325px;
	float: left;
}
.bfeatpic {
	float: left;
	width: 93px;
}
html>body .bfeatcontent {
	width: 205px;
}
.bfeatcontent {
	float: left;
	width: 215px;
	padding: 0 10px 0 0;
}

.titlefeature {
	font-size: 24px;
	line-height: 30px;
	color: #575756;
}


#sectionnews {
	position:relative;
	height: 170px;
	background: #fff url('../images/rightbargray.jpg') no-repeat top right;
}
#sectcentnewscontent {
	position:relative;
	width: 1000px;
	height: 170px;
	margin-left: auto;
	margin-right: auto;
	background: #fff url('../images/front_right_gray.jpg') no-repeat top right;	
}
.newstitle {
	font-size: 16px;
	line-height: 25px;
	color: #575756;
}
#boxtitlenews {
	padding: 0 0 0 16px;
}
html>body #newslinks {
	width: 326px;
}
#newslinks {
	float: left;
	width: 400px;
	padding: 30px 0 0 74px;
}
#newslinks ul {
	padding: 0;
	margin:0;
}
#newslinks ul a:link,
#newslinks ul a:active,
#newslinks ul a:visited
{
	font-weight: normal;
	padding: 0 0 0 16px;
	background: url('../images/pijl.jpg') no-repeat left center;
}
#newslinks ul li {
	margin-bottom: 4px;
}

#boxproducts {
	width: 490px;
	height: 170px;
	float: left;
	position: relative;
}
#prodimage {
	position: absolute;
	top:10px;
	left: -40px;
}
#prodimagecnt {
	width: 160px;
	position: absolute;
	top:20px;
	left: 255px;
}
#bookmarks {
	width: 115px;
	position: absolute;
	top:20px;
	right: 10px;
}
#bkmcnt {
	position: relative;
}
#verticalline1 {
	position: absolute;
	top:10px;
	left: 400px;
	background: url('../images/verticalsep.png') no-repeat;
	width: 1px;
	height: 138px;
	z-index: 10;
}
#verticalline2 {
	position: absolute;
	top:10px;
	left: 840px;
	background: url('../images/verticalsep.png') no-repeat;
	width: 1px;
	height: 138px;
	z-index: 10;
}

html>body #sectsitemapcnt {
	width: 910px;
}
#sectsitemapcnt {
	width: 1000px;
	margin-left: auto;
	margin-right: auto;
	color:#fff;
	padding: 0 0 0 90px;
}
#sectsitemapcnt p {
	color:#fff;
}
#paddsitemap {
height:30px;
}
.collinks {
	float: left;
	width: 145px;
}
.linksmtitle {
	font-weight: bold;
	color: #fff;
	font-size:10px;
}
.collinks ul {
	padding:0;
	margin: 2px 0 0px 0;
	list-style-type:none;
}
.collinks ul li {

}
.collinks ul li a:link,
.collinks ul li a:active,
.collinks ul li a:visited
{
	text-decoration: none;
	color: #9d9d9c;
	font-size:10px;
	font-weight: normal;
}
.collinks ul li a:hover
{
	text-decoration: none;
}
.collinks ul li a.active:link,
.collinks ul li a.active:active,
.collinks ul li a.active:visited
{
	text-decoration: underline;
	font-weight: normal;
}

.spacersitmap {
	height: 30px;
}
#linesitemap {
	height: 1px;
	border-bottom: solid 1px #424242;
}

#sectionlegal {
}
html>body #sectlegalcnt {
	width: 904px;
}
#sectlegalcnt {
	width: 1000px;
	margin-left: auto;
	margin-right: auto;
	color: #9d9d9c;
	font-size:10px;
	line-height: 14px;
	padding: 0 0 0 96px;
}
#sectlegalcnt a:link,
#sectlegalcnt a:active,
#sectlegalcnt a:visited
{
	text-decoration: none;
	color: #9d9d9c;
	font-size:10px;
	line-height: 14px;	
	font-weight: normal;
}
#sectlegalcnt a:hover
{
	text-decoration: underline;
}

/* Page details */
html>body #sectioncontent {
	min-height: 620px;
	height: auto;
}
#sectioncontent {
	height: 620px;
	background: #fff url('../images/bgleftnews.jpg') no-repeat 0 20px;
}
#sectioncontentdetails {
	width: 1000px;
	margin-left: auto;
	margin-right: auto;
	position: relative;
	background: #fff url('../images/bgrightnews.jpg') no-repeat -160px 20px;
}
html>body #colcnt1 {
	width: 310px;
}
#colcnt1 {
	width: 390px;
	float: left;
	padding: 30px 0 20px 80px;
}
#colcnt1 h1,
#colcnt1 h2
{
	margin-left: 15px;
}
#colcnt1 ul {
	margin: 0;
	padding:0;
}
#colcnt1 ul li {
list-style-type:none;
}
#colcnt1 ul li a:link,
#colcnt1 ul li a:active,
#colcnt1 ul li a:visited
{
	padding: 2px 0 2px 20px;
	display: block;
font-size: 14px;
line-height:24px;
font-family:Lucida,Verdana,Arial;
}
#colcnt1top p a:link,
#colcnt1top p a:active,
#colcnt1top p a:visited,
#colcnt1 ul li a:hover,
#colcnt1 ul li a.active:link,
#colcnt1 ul li a.active:active,
#colcnt1 ul li a.active:visited
{
	background: url('../images/pijlgrijs.jpg') no-repeat 0 6px;
	text-decoration: none;
}
html>body #colcnt2 {
	width: 480px;
	min-height: 450px;
	height: auto;
}
#colcnt2 {
	width: 570px;
	height: 500px;
	float: left;
	padding: 30px 50px 20px 40px;
}

/* Various */
.spacer {
	width:100%;
	background: #fff;
	height:2px;
}

html>body #colcnt1top
{
width: 260px;
}
#colcnt1top
{
padding-left:20px;
padding-bottom: 15px;
width: 280px;
}
#colcnt1nav
{
padding-left:0px;
padding-bottom: 20px;
}
#colcnt1btm
{
padding-left:10px;
}

#colcnt2 p a:link,
#colcnt2 p a:active,
#colcnt2 p a:visited
{
text-decoration:none;
}

#sectionsitemap ul li,
.boxfeature ul li,
#sectcentnewscontent ul li  
{
list-style-type: none;
}

#colcnt2 a.linknews:link,
#colcnt2 a.linknews:active,
#colcnt2 a.linknews:visited
{
text-decoration:none;
padding:0 0 0 20px;
}
#colcnt2 a.linknews:hover
{
text-decoration:none;
background:url('../images/pijlwit.jpg') no-repeat left center;
}

.contenttop {
padding-left: 20px;
}

a#cnext:link,
a#cnext:active,
a#cnext:visited
{
display:block;
width:33px;
height:20px;
background: url('../images/pijl1rechts.jpg') no-repeat;
position: absolute;
top: 100px;
right: 20px;
}
a#cnext:hover
{
background: url('../images/pijl3rechts.jpg') no-repeat;
}

a#cprev:link,
a#cprev:active,
a#cprev:visited
{
display:block;
width:33px;
height:20px;
background: url('../images/pijl1links.jpg') no-repeat;
position: absolute;
top: 100px;
left: -50px;
}
a#cprev:hover
{
background: url('../images/pijl3links.jpg') no-repeat;
}

.inputtext {
padding-left: 5px;
}


html>body .fileprofile {
width: 338px;
height: 21px;
}
.fileprofile {
width: 398px;
height: 25px;
padding: 4px 30px 0 30px;
margin-bottom: 2px;
background:url('../images/download.jpg') no-repeat;
}
.filepdf {
width: 398px;
height: 25px;
padding: 4px 30px 0 30px;
margin-bottom: 2px;
background:url('../images/download_pdf.jpg') no-repeat;
}

.fileprofile a:link,
.fileprofile a:active,
.fileprofile a:visited,
.filepdf a:link,
.filepdf a:active,
.filepdf a:visited
{
text-decoration:none;
}

.hidePrevLink,
.hideNextLink
{
display:none;
}

a.numberActive:link,
a.numberActive:active,
a.numberActive:visited
{
text-decoration: none;
}
